Neal D. Barnard, MD, is a leader in preventive medicine, nutrition, and research, an adjunct associate professor of medicine at George Washington University, and a researcher funded by the National Institutes of Health. He is editor-in-chief of the Nutrition Guide for Clinicians and the author of over 15 books on nutrition and health. Founder of the Physicians Committee for Responsible Medicine, Dr.
Barnard is in great demand as a lecturer around the country, and is frequently called upon by the news media and popular broadcast programs to discuss health and nutrition. He has appeared on Oprah, Ellen, Today, Good Morning America, the Early Show, and many other broadcast programs. His
work on nutrition and diabetes was thesubject of an hour-long PBS program in March, 2010.
